Leo Borg at the start with two wildcards in Marbella
Tennis junior Leo Borg will take part in the ATP Challenger tournament in Marbella this week.

Leo Borg has received wild cards for two tournaments in Marbella: For the ATP Challenger 80 event, which has already started this week. As for the qualification of the ATP 250 tournament, which starts next week (the qualification is already on the weekend).
At the Challenger tournament, Borg faces tough competition: Roberto Carballes Baena, currently number 96 in the world, is the top seed ahead of Norbert Gambos. Prominent names such as Jaume Munar, Gianluca Mager and Martin Klizan are also there. Ernests Gulbis was already successful at the start.
Borg in round 1 against Taro Daniel
In his first round game, Borg meets Taro Daniel, who is seeded at six, and is currently number 118 in the tennis world. Daniel rose to fame in 2018 when he beat Novak Djokovic in Indian Wells.
Borg is currently without a world ranking. The 17-year-old celebrated his greatest success at junior level just a few weeks ago when he won the G1 tournament in Porto Alegre .
In his previous Challenger appearances in 2020 in Bergamo and Pau, he was defeated at the start - in Pau he lost to Gulbis.
Holger Rune is no longer there: The youngster, who recently celebrated his first victories at the ATP Tour level and recently trained with Novak Djokovic , lost the qualification in the last round in Marbella.
From an Austrian point of view, Sebastian Ofner is at the start, he will play against Jaume Munar, who was seeded at Dre.
